2+2 means it has a back seat, the roof is longer and that body style in general is less desirable but they have their fans, the 83 came in both N/A and Turbo, both are Inline 6 cylinder engines, the n/a make about 160 hp at the crank while the turbo make 180 hp at the crank, RUST is a big problem on these, if's it's not glass ro rubber look for rust! expext about 20 mpg , the turbo manual model came with a stronger T5 transmision, the motors are good for around 300k if they aren't abused, they have 4 wheel disk brakes and 4 wheel independent suspension, the miles are low but the price still seems a bit high as the 2+2 models are less sought after, if it's got a digital dash readout you could encouter problems there, but all in all they are retty trouble free cars, they weight right at 3000 so they aren't light weightm the diffs are all open so they can be tricky in rain snow and ice, ...did I miss anything?
